Western Union Halts Cuba Money Transfers Amid Renewed U.S. Sanctions

Western Union suspended money transfers to Cuba after the U.S. reinstated sanctions on Cuban military-run businesses, impacting Cuban-American families sending about $100 monthly to relatives and prompting mixed reactions.

Proposed US Tax on Remittances Threatens Mexican Economy

A proposed tax on remittances sent from the US to Mexico, potentially reaching 50%, threatens the $5 billion monthly lifeline supporting millions in Mexico, prompting concerns about enforcement and the use of alternative transfer methods.

Mexican Deportations: Economic Consequences and Migration

Mass deportation of Mexican workers from the U.S. would severely impact the \$63 billion in annual remittances to Mexico, potentially causing economic devastation and paradoxically increasing Mexican migration due to increased economic desperation.
